As per a recent announcement and subsequent NY Times article, the US Postal Service is accepting recommendations for living persons to be on a US Stamp, and I believe R.E.M. is quite deserving. So, why not R.E.M.?  I formed a FB page about it and you can either request it yourself on the USPS Facebook page and/or "like" my post that is already on its recommendation section on the right, send a written request to the USPS by mail, or join my FB group concerning it.  I will be sending an official correspondence.

Citizens’ Stamp Advisory Committee, c/o Stamp Development, Room 3300, 475 L'Enfant Plaza SW, Washington DC 20260-3501
